Title: The Innovations of Masato Kawakami
Introduction
Masato Kawakami is a notable inventor based in Misato, Japan. He has made significant contributions to the field of liquid supply and ink jet technology. With a total of three patents to his name, Kawakami's work has had a considerable impact on the industry.
Latest Patents
Kawakami's latest patents include a liquid supply apparatus and a liquid ejection apparatus with contactless detection of liquid remaining amount. This innovative liquid supply apparatus features a supply passage that transports liquid from a storage section to a liquid ejection head. It incorporates a region where pressure varies based on the amount of liquid remaining, along with a gas chamber that communicates with this region. A pressure sensor detects the pressure in the gas chamber, enhancing the efficiency of the apparatus. Another significant patent involves an ink jet recording ink that includes a pigment, water, and water-soluble compounds. This ink formulation utilizes a resin-dispersed pigment and specific water-soluble compounds to achieve optimal performance in ink jet recording applications.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Kawakami has worked with prominent companies such as Canon Finetech Inc. and Canon Kabushiki Kaisha. His experience in these organizations has allowed him to refine his skills and contribute to groundbreaking innovations in the field.
Collaborations
Kawakami has collaborated with talented individuals, including Kanako Aratani and Ryuta Aoto. These partnerships have fostered a creative environment that has led to the development of advanced technologies.
